DMACC women's basketball team ends five-game losing streak

Freshman Jada Powell of Des Moines recorded a double-double with 23 points and 14 rebounds as the Des Moines Area Community College (DMACC) women's basketball team ended a five-game losing streak with an 80-64 win over Marshalltown Community College (MCC) November 19 inside the DMACC gymnasium.

 

Sophomore Asia Mena of Chicago, Ill., freshman Riley Gatton of Montezuma and sophomore Taelor Lessmeier of Fort Dodge also reached double-figures with 18, 13 and 12 points respectively as the Bears improved to 3-5 for the season and avenged a 68-64 loss to MCC on Nov. 19.

 

DMACC led throughout the game. The Bears were up 16-9 at the end of the first quarter, 36-25 at halftime and 56-47 at the end of the third quarter. They shot 54 percent in the win, making 32 of 59 field goal attempts. DMACC was 7-of-17 from three-point range and 9-of-19 from the free throw line.

 

Powell's 14 rebounds led the Bears to a 42-33 advantage on the boards. Mena and freshman Katelyn Courtney of Ames had five rebounds apiece and Mena topped DMACC in assists with four. Courtney also had three assists and led the Bears in steals with three.

 

The DMACC women's basketball team will play County Upper Academy (CUA) Nov. 23 inside the DMACC gymnasium. Game time is 1 p.m .
